This is an interesting roll find. I did some research and I think it is double struck, flipped, and slightly rotated. Has anyone seen anything like this before or know any more about it? I checked completed ebay listings and I didn't see anything similar, does anyone have any idea what it might be worth?

A very nice find, indeed. This is an in-collar, flipover double strike.

Such an error is by no means unique. They are rather rare, however. In AU condition (which is what this appears to be) I'd estimate its value at $100 - $125.
